A dime is about 1 mm thick. how many dimes are in a stack 1 cm high

There are 10 mm in a cm.

If each dime is 1 mm then 10 dimes will be 1 cm high

1 dime / 1 mm = x dimes / 10 mm Cross multiply

1 dime * 10 mm = x * 1 mm

10 dimes = x The mm cancel out.
